Strong Pool of Canadian Riders for Road World Championships

Ramsden, Hughes, Kirchmann and Shaw in the hunt for Road Cycling World Championships

The 2012 UCI Road World Championships, is set for September 15 to 23 in Limburg, Netherlands.

The Elite Women pool is headlined by Canadian Champions Denise Ramsden and Clara Hughes, who took the Canadian titles in the Road race and Time Trials respectively. Leah Kirchmann and Rhea Shaw received Automatic selection to the pool, winning medals at the 2012 UCI Pan-American Championships in Mar del Plata, Argentina, earlier this spring.

Antoine Duchesne, who won the U23 road race at the recent Canadian Championships, and Hugo Houle, who posted the fastest time in the ITT among the young riders, will also be strong contenders for the World Championships.

Tara Whitten is also in the selection pool. Whitten was Canada’s top rider at the 2011 edition of the Road World Championships, finishing in fourth place in the women’s time trial.
